When we talk about domestic violence, we usually picture a male abuser and a female victim, but what about the cases that don’t fit that narrative? Reality TV star Taylor Frankie Paul's season of "The Bachelorette" got yanked after an absolutely horrid video dropped of her abusing her male partner and their kid. How often does female-on-male abuse actually happen, and why don’t we hear about it? Are male victims taken seriously, or do stigma and stereotypes keep them silent? If a man says he’s being abused, how do you react? Do you believe him, or does something about that still feel hard to accept? Leah M. Forney, "The Culture Doctor," joins Ian Hoch to have a serious discussion of gender roles in the perception of domestic abuse.
